Period of Availability:
02/10/2014 - 16/10/2014, 04:00 GMT/UTC

Event Conditions:
Type: Single Race
Start Procedure: Rolling Start
Duration: 5 Laps

Eligible Cars:
Categories: Normal Car

Entry Requirements:
PP: 500 or less
Tyres: Sports Soft or less
Nitrous: Cannot be Fitted

Prizes:
Gold: Cr.200,000
Silver: Cr.120,000
Bronze: Cr.100,000

Gift(s):
Gold: GT METALLIC 006-W paint chip.

Track Conditions:
Track: Circuit de Spa-Francorchamps
Track Length: 4.35 miles / 7000 m
Time of day: 15:40
Temp: 19ºc
Precipitation: 100% [Rain will slowly stop and track surface drys progressively throughout]

Typical Opponents:
AC Cars 427 S/C '66
Alfa Romeo 8C Competizione '08
Aston Martin DB7 Vantage Coupe '00

Collision and Short Cut Penalties are active for this race.

Pretty easy to be honest, the AI is really slow in the wet. Nice to see the track drying over the race though - it changes each time you do it too. I've run it 3 times now, twice in an Evo IV and once in an F430, 9% as I crossed the line the first time, 33% the second and 11% the third time. As long as you stay off the racing line for the first 3 laps you'll have more grip, once it really starts to dry you can run the normal line again.
